We'll just disagree on this. His 1996 team played at a fast pace (averaged 82.6 ppg), and yet held opponents to only 64.7 ppg--good for 33rd in the nation...not adjusting for pace. The team could play D, and that meant some of it fell on Ray. Was he a star on D? No.

But he averaged 23.4 ppg while shooting 47% from the field, and 46% from 3. Also, add in that he averaged 6.5 rebounds per game (second on the team) and 3.5 apg, despite playing next to Doron Sheffer. He was also second on the team in steals, right behind Sheffer. So he was first or second on the team in all those categories. That season is unreal.

He did have a better individual season than Shabazz...but I'll give Shabazz the better career with 2 titles to go with the first team AA.
 
I know it was a different era but can you imagine if there was a 3 point line back when Wes Bialosuknia played for the Huskies
He was one of the best pure shooters the Huskies ever had. He lit up the old Fieldhouse and averaged 23.6 PPG without the 3 point line. He also played with Toby Kimball and I believe Bill Holowaty. Some great basketball back then in the Yankee Conference.
